#0c5825 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c5825 is composed of 4.7% red, 34.5%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 58%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 139.7 degrees, a saturation of 76% and a lightness of 19.6%. #0c5825 color hex could be obtained by blending #18b04a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#0c5825
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#effd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c5825
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f3531 is the less saturated color, while #006421 is the most saturated one.
